seedfaker: เซิร์ฟเวอร์ MCP สำหรับข้อมูลปลอมที่มีโครงสร้างและสมจริง
seedfaker ซึ่งพัฒนาโดย Opendsr Std เป็นเซิร์ฟเวอร์ MCP ที่ให้ LLMs เข้าถึงข้อมูลปลอมที่มีโครงสร้างและสมจริงตามต้องการสำหรับการพัฒนาและการทดสอบ มันสร้างชื่อ ที่อยู่ อีเมล ฟิลด์การเงิน และบันทึกปลอมอื่น ๆ ผ่านชุดโมดูล Faker ที่รวมอยู่ ส่งคืนผลลัพธ์ที่จัดรูปแบบสำหรับการบริโภคของโมเดล มุ่งเป้าไปที่นักพัฒนาซอฟต์แวร์ วิศวกร QA และนักวิจัย AI มันช่วยในการเติมฐานข้อมูล สร้างต้นแบบ UI และจำลองการโต้ตอบของผู้ใช้ภายในเวิร์กโฟลว์ที่ขับเคลื่อนโดย MCP.
สิ่งที่ seedfaker เปิดใช้งานภายในกระบวนการทำงานของตัวแทนที่ขับเคลื่อนด้วย MCP
seedfaker ให้เครื่องมือที่เรียกใช้งานได้ เพื่อให้ตัวแทนที่เข้ากันได้กับ MCP สามารถขอระเบียนตัวอย่างได้โดยตรงในระหว่างเซสชัน เซิร์ฟเวอร์จะเปิดเผยตัวสร้างที่ใช้ Faker ซึ่งครอบคลุมโมดูลต่างๆ เช่น บุคคล ที่อยู่ อินเทอร์เน็ต การเงิน และโมดูลที่คล้ายกัน และส่งคืนระเบียนที่มีโครงสร้างซึ่งโมเดลและเครื่องมือที่อยู่ด้านล่างสามารถแยกวิเคราะห์ได้ ผลลัพธ์ทั่วไปประกอบด้วยวัตถุที่พร้อมสำหรับ CSV และระเบียน JSON ที่เหมาะสมสำหรับการสร้างฐานข้อมูล อุปกรณ์ UI หรือการจำลองการโต้ตอบแบบสคริปต์
ความเชื่อถือได้ของผลลัพธ์ที่สร้างขึ้นสำหรับการทดสอบ
เนื่องจากตัวสร้างใช้ไลบรารี Faker ผลลัพธ์จึงมีลักษณะคล้ายรูปแบบในโลกจริงโดยไม่ใช้ข้อมูลส่วนบุคคลจริง; โครงการจะทำเครื่องหมายระเบียนที่สร้างขึ้นว่าเป็นสังเคราะห์อย่างชัดเจน นั่นทำให้ข้อมูลสามารถใช้งานได้สำหรับการทดสอบและต้นแบบในสถานการณ์ที่สมจริงในขณะที่หลีกเลี่ยงการใช้ตัวตนจริงโดยไม่ตั้งใจ ทีมงานควรตรวจสอบระเบียนกับสคีมาของตนเองและข้อจำกัดก่อนที่จะนำเข้าสู่ระบบการผลิตเพื่อป้องกันการไม่ตรงกันของประเภทหรือความยาว
สิ่งที่คุณต้องการเพื่อเรียกใช้และวิธีที่มันเข้ากับกระบวนการทำงานของนักพัฒนา
seedfaker ทำงานเป็นเซิร์ฟเวอร์ MCP ท้องถิ่น โดยต้องการสภาพแวดล้อม Node.js และโฮสต์ที่เข้ากันได้กับ MCP เช่น Claude Desktop ซึ่งสามารถเรียกใช้งานได้ผ่านคำสั่งการกำหนดค่า โมเดลเซิร์ฟเวอร์จะเก็บตรรกะการสร้างไว้ภายในสภาพแวดล้อมของผู้ใช้และเสนออินเทอร์เฟซที่สามารถขยายได้เพื่อให้นักพัฒนาสามารถเพิ่มหรือตั้งค่าฟังก์ชัน Faker เพิ่มเติมเป็นเครื่องมือ Opendsr เผยแพร่โครงการในฐานะโอเพนซอร์ส สนับสนุนการรวมเข้ากับการทดสอบ CI และการตั้งค่าการพัฒนาท้องถิ่น
การตัดสินใจที่เป็นประโยชน์: มีประโยชน์สำหรับการทดสอบที่มุ่งเน้น MCP, ต้องการการตรวจสอบสคีมา
สำหรับทีมที่ใช้ตัวแทน MCP, seedfaker เป็นตัวเลือกที่เป็นประโยชน์ที่จัดหาบันทึกจำลองที่สมจริงโดยตรงให้กับเวิร์กโฟลว์ที่ขับเคลื่อนด้วยโมเดล; มันเหมาะสมที่สุดสำหรับการพัฒนา, QA, และการสร้างต้นแบบ คาดหวังข้อมูลสังเคราะห์เท่านั้น, ดังนั้นให้รวมการตรวจสอบสคีมาอัตโนมัติและการทำความสะอาดข้อมูลในสายการผลิตของคุณก่อนที่จะนำเข้าบันทึกที่สร้างขึ้นไปยังฐานข้อมูลหรือระบบวิเคราะห์.